Lepara
A SePitori word that usually refers to a guy that can handle difficult situations, or is brave enough to do things other people can't do.
It could also mean someone who is well respected because of his status in society.
Mpho ke lepara joe, he just approached that hot girl sitting over there.
Mauritian Rupee
Currency of Mauritius (MUR) issued by the Bank of Mauritius. 1 Rupee = 100 cents.
Features images of Sir Seewoosagur Ramgoolam and local wildlife.
North West
North West is an inland South African province that borders Botswana. Its landscape is defined by mountains in the northeast and bushveld scattered with trees and shrubs.
